I would like to retrofit my house to use radiant. One problem is that the house is half on slab and half over a finished basement, so I need a system that can work for all three types (over slab, over rafters, and basement). At least I do have cathedral ceilings so I could raise the floor some if needed (and over an existing slab, it looks like I would probably need to add a 2 to 3 inches to get radiant). I like the idea of the low-mass systems like warmboard, but not sure if warmboard makes sense in a retrofit as opposed to new construction. Looks like there are several other systems like WarmRite and EasyFloor that might make more sense if they are just going over an existing subfloor, but I haven't seen any good reviews/recommendations for them. Any advice or experiences would be most appreciated.
